Background

Network Rail owns and manages the railway infrastructure in Great Britain, which includes over 20,000 miles of track, 30,000 bridges, tunnels, and viaducts, and thousands of signals, level crossings, and stations. It also owns and runs 20 of the country’s largest railway stations. Their work impacts the millions of people who travel by rail, and the lineside neighbours whose businesses and homes are next to the railway.

Network Rail has a diverse audience requiring different types of information through different channels, from customers reporting incidents and asking questions to businesses helping to improve the railway.
